Meet Stephanie Goetz, a businesswoman, leadership coach, philanthropist, professional pilot, TEDx speaker, and professional singer.


Stephanie Goetz is a modern-day Renaissance woman. She is an award-winning former news and sports anchor at NBC, CBS, and ABC, a businesswoman, executive communication, leadership coach, philanthropist, professional pilot, TEDx speaker, and professional singer. As a keynote speaker, coach and mentor, she guides leaders and professionals on their personal development journeys, helping them to discover their potential, shatter their own glass ceiling, and achieve their goals.


Stephanie’s multifaceted career and commitment to personal growth serve as a powerful inspiration to all. Professionally, she has five jet type ratings and is qualified to fly multiple
aircraft types. She flew the Bombardier Global 6000/5000/5500 for the world’s largest and most prestigious private jet company. She performs in air shows and competes in aerobatic competitions. Stephanie is also a flight instructor and flies an L-39 Albatros – a military trainer jet.

 

Stephanie has a storied past of perseverance, determination, and overcoming significant obstacles. At a young age, she tragically lost her only siblings – her beloved older brothers – followed by the loss of numerous family members. Stephanie was able to dig deep and persevere through immense loss and build multiple successful careers in broadcast, entrepreneurship, aviation, singing, and more. She discovered how to be limitless. And she now teaches others how to LEVEL UP and go from dreaming to doing and achieving anything they desire.


Stephanie rose quickly in business aviation and was awarded the distinguished NBAA (National Business Aviation Association) Top 40 Under 40 Award as one of the outstanding professionals in that field.


Stephanie and her husband are deeply committed to building up and empowering the next generation of professionals and aviators. Stephanie, in particular, has been instrumental in starting a non-profit to empower mental health called Imagine Thriving which has helped thousands across the upper Midwest. She and her husband have also donated tens of thousands of dollars in multi-engine scholarships to underrepresented groups in aviation (OBAP - Organization of Black Aerospace Professionals, Women in Aviation, Sisters of the Skies, NGPA - National Gay Pilots Association) and even donated an airplane to the Luke Weather Flight Academy.
